The Super Bowl Needs a Super POS

Where will you be watching the biggest football game of the year? Fans in the South Florida area proclaim Duffy’s Sports Grill’s 24 award-winning locations as the ideal place to catch Super Bowl fever – in fact, Duffy’s North Miami Beach location was named the best place to watch the Super Bowl by Travel and Leisure Magazine in 2011! Situated directly on the Intracoastal waterway, with a huge collection of screens inside and out, Duffy’s at North Miami Beach ensures that all their patrons have unobstructed views of the game even with Super Bowl-sized crowds.

Demand for Duffy’s delicious hand-breaded and tossed wings, served with the choice of eight sauces, and their superb Power Play Punch will be at an all-time high on Sunday, but Duffy’s Sports Grill can handle even on the busiest game-time rushes with ease using Pinnacle Hospitality Systems’ POSitouch POS for bars. Duffy’s bartenders can keep drinks flowing swiftly with the industry’s fastest service – they can order an item or cash out the check with just two key strokes. Pinnacle’s sports bar POS will keep service consistent and swift by letting servers start tabs including the customers’ names with just the swipe of a customer’s credit card.

Owner Paul Emmet was able to add Duffy’s Big Game Blowout takeout deal to all 24 of his restaurants from a single terminal with Pinnacle’s restaurant POS. Duffy’s daily Homeplate Specials and happy hours are a breeze to offer with Pinnacle’s flexible menu and price functionality that allows Emmet to configure by workstation, day of week and time of day. After the Super Bowl frenzy is over, Emmet can use the data analysis available with POSitouch’s bar POS to compare how each of his locations performed and which items were the most popular. He can query items by major cat, cost center, and user, displaying results on screen or sending them to a POS printer for hard copies.

POS For Restaurant Gift Card Service

Frazzled holiday shoppers everywhere are fighting crowds in the search for the perfect gift. Come to their rescue! Offer gift cards at your restaurant and take the hassle out of gift giving, but make sure to have the right POS for restaurant gift card service one the customer arrives to redeem it. Once looked upon as impersonal, restaurant gift cards have been growing in popularity as holiday gifts among recipients and gifters alike. According to National Restaurant Association research, more than half (59 percent) of consumers last year were hoping to find a restaurant gift card under their tree, and more are expected to be looking this year. On September 19, 2011, Sydney, 15, was diagnosed with Ewing’s Sarcoma, a rare pediatric bone cancer. SIDES (Sydney’s Incredible Defeat of Ewing’s Sarcoma) was formed and quickly qualified as a 501(c)(3) charity. Sydney helped design the SIDES logo and was involved in fundraisers to help raise money for pediatric cancer research. In 10 short months SIDES has raised over $165,000.00.
